Kolleno vs Upflow
AR & collections head-to-head for ERP teams: evidenced capabilities, published pricing, and which ERPs each actually integrates with.
| Starting price | Per-user subscription, tiered by annual turnover | Tiered by company ARR; quote-based for paid plans |
| Deployment | Cloud | Cloud |
| Company size | — | — |
| Stated ERP integrations | NetSuite, Xero, QuickBooks, Sage Intacct, SAP, Microsoft Dynamics 365 | NetSuite, QuickBooks, Xero, Sage Intacct |
| Vendor | Kolleno | Upflow |
Our take
Where Kolleno leads
- Stronger evidenced coverage on 17 of the 22 capabilities where they differ (led by customer/account segmentation and partial and bulk payment handling).
- Stated SAP, Microsoft Dynamics 365 integration the alternative doesn't list.
Where Upflow leads
- Stronger evidenced coverage on 5 of the 22 capabilities where they differ (led by autopay / scheduled payments and peer benchmarking).
Where they differ
The 22 capabilities (of 52 in the AR & collections taxonomy) where the evidence separates them, biggest gaps first. “Not evidenced” means our research found no public documentation of this capability — the vendor may still offer it. Confirm on a demo.

Kolleno vs Upflow — FAQs
Is Kolleno or Upflow better for ERP integration?
Both state integrations with NetSuite, Xero, QuickBooks, Sage Intacct. Kolleno additionally lists SAP, Microsoft Dynamics 365. Always verify the connector against your ERP version with a reference customer.
Which is cheaper, Kolleno or Upflow?
Neither publishes a list price — both quote. Ask each for the all-in first-year cost at your seat count, as one number, and compare those.
